Thank you for pointing me to that issue !2857 <https://gitlab.isc.org/isc-projects/bind9/-/issues/2857>, that's exactly what I hit. Now when I see the details, it makes sense.
I have cleared the domain from all keys and dnssec-policy settings. Then assigned the dnssec-policy to unsigned domain and bam, CDS+CDNSKEY records are published after time specified in policy. No big deal, it's a test domain, rollover is not a problem. > > I am sorry, I am afraid you hit a bug: > https://gitlab.isc.org/isc-projects/bind9/-/issues/2857 > > The legacy key metadata has no information about the role of keys. It > determines the role from the key flags: 256 means it is a ZSK, and 257 > is converted to a KSK. In other words, migrating a CSK won't work. > > I am working on a fix so that you will be able to migrate CSKs. > > For now I have added a warning to the KB article. > > > > Since my TLD supports CDNSKEY, I want to leverage it. I kind of expected bind topublish them on PublishCDS: > > 20210811135045 (Wed Aug 11 15:50:45 2021) automatically. > > The metadata is indeed an indication of when certain events are expected > to happen. But if BIND determines it is not safe to do so, there may be > a delay. > > From the output below, it looks like not all zone signatures have been > propagated yet: > > > - zone rrsig: rumoured > > The PublishCDS metadata is usually set to the the time that the DNSKEY > has been published, plus dnskey-ttl, zone-propagation-delay, and > publish-safety. If it is the first key for the zone, the time to > propagate the zone signatures is taken into account.
